如何使用SAS删除指定逻辑库数据库 (sas删除某逻辑库数据库)
SAS是一个广泛使用的统计分析软件,它允许用户通过简单的命令和程序来处理数据、进行分析和制作报告。在SAS中,逻辑库是一种组织和管理数据的方式。它将数据从物理文件中分离出来,并按主题进行组织,使数据管理更加方便和灵活。但有时,我们需要清理和删除一些逻辑库来节省空间或重新组织数据。本文将介绍。
步骤1:确认要删除的逻辑库
在开始删除逻辑库之前,首先需要确认要删除的逻辑库的名称和位置。可以通过SAS中的LIBNAME语句或使用SAS管理器来查找逻辑库的位置。例如,如果要删除名为“MYLIB”的逻辑库,可以使用以下代码在SAS中打印出逻辑库的位置:
“`SAS
LIBNAME mylib;
“`
或者,可以使用SAS管理器来查找并确认要删除的逻辑库的位置。在SAS管理器中,选择要删除的逻辑库并单击右键,然后选择“属性”选项。在逻辑库属性中,可以找到逻辑库的路径和名称。
步骤2:关闭逻辑库
在删除逻辑库之前,需要确保所有与逻辑库相关的任务和程序都已关闭,否则逻辑库将被保留并无法删除。因此,在删除逻辑库之前,请关闭所有使用该逻辑库的SAS程序、任务和应用程序。
步骤3:使用PROC DATASETS删除逻辑库
一旦确认要删除的逻辑库的名称和位置,并关闭所有使用该逻辑库的SAS程序,就可以使用SAS中的PROC DATASETS步骤来删除逻辑库。PROC DATASETS允许用户操作SAS数据集,并提供许多操作数据集的选项,例如备份、恢复、复制、删除等。
在删除逻辑库时,使用以下代码:
“`SAS
PROC DATASETS LIBRARY = mylib KILL;
RUN;
“`
上述代码将删除名为“MYLIB”的逻辑库。在代码中,“PROC DATASETS”指定了要使用PROC DATASETS步骤来删除逻辑库,“LIBRARY = mylib”指定了要删除的逻辑库名称是“MYLIB”,“KILL”指定将执行删除操作。
:
本文介绍了。删除逻辑库需要确认要删除的逻辑库名称和位置,并在删除之前关闭所有与逻辑库相关的SAS程序,然后使用PROC DATASETS步骤进行删除。删除逻辑库可能会造成数据的永久丢失,请谨慎操作。